Annual Report is a document containing the yearly report published by a company or organization at the end of their fiscal year. This document includes important information about the company’s performance during that year, as well as projections and business plans for the following year. Why is the Annual Report Important?

Annual Report, or yearly report, is a very important document for companies and their shareholders. Here are some reasons why annual report is considered so important:

1. Transparency and Openness

Annual report is one way for a company to show transparency and openness to shareholders and other stakeholders. In this report, the company must provide a clear overview of their performance, strategies taken, and issues faced. This is a form of honest and open communication, which is crucial in building trust.

2. Detailed Financial Information

Annual report provides very detailed financial information about the company. This includes assets, liabilities, revenue, and profit throughout the year. This information is valuable for investors and financial analysts to evaluate the financial performance of the company. They can see how the company manages its finances and whether it is profitable.

3. Performance Evaluation Tool

This document is used by stakeholders, especially shareholders, to assess how far the company has achieved its goals. It also helps evaluate how successful the strategies implemented are. For example, whether the company has met its set growth targets or improved operational efficiency.

4. Basis for Decision Making

The information presented in the annual report is not just for viewing, but also serves as a basis for making decisions. Shareholders and company management rely on the data and analysis in this report to make important business decisions. For example, whether to invest more in product development or explore new market opportunities.

In other words, annual report is not just a regulatory requirement or formality. It is an important tool in running a business transparently, providing very valuable information, and helping in making smart decisions.

Main Contents of the Annual Report

The Annual Report is a document rich with important information about the company’s performance and condition over one year. Here are the main contents usually found in an annual report:

1. Letter from Management

Annual report often begins with a letter from the CEO or senior management. This letter provides a brief overview of the company’s performance during the year, as well as the company’s vision and future plans. It is an opportunity for management to speak directly to shareholders and other stakeholders.

2. Annual Financial Report

This is the most substantial part of the annual report. It includes the complete financial statements such as the balance sheet, income statement, and cash flow statement. This information helps shareholders understand the company’s financial performance during the year. By analyzing these numbers, shareholders can assess how well the company has achieved its goals.

3. Financial Notes

This section explains in detail the information behind the figures in the financial statements. It includes accounting policies used, underlying estimates, and additional details needed to understand the financial reports. This helps clarify financial data which might be complex for shareholders without accounting background.

4. Operational Overview

This section provides a general overview of the company’s operations during the year. It covers major achievements, changes in company structure, and ongoing projects. This information helps shareholders understand what the company has done during the year.

5. Strategic Review

Annual report often includes a strategic review detailing the company’s goals and plans for the future. This covers business strategies taken, risks identified, and steps to manage those risks. It provides deep insight into the company’s direction and plans.

6. Corporate Governance

This document also includes information about corporate governance. It covers existing committees, board composition, and governance principles followed. This is an important part to show how the company is managed well and according to good governance principles.

The main contents of an annual report provide a comprehensive summary of the company’s performance, financial condition, and plans for the future. This is a key tool for communicating with shareholders and stakeholders, giving them deep insight into how the company operates and manages its assets.

Purpose of the Annual Report

Annual report is a document that has several main purposes important to the company and its shareholders. Here are those purposes:

1. Present Performance

One of the main purposes of the annual report is to present the company’s performance during one year transparently and clearly. This includes disclosing achievements, developments, and challenges faced during the period.

2. Fulfill Legal Obligations

In many jurisdictions, companies have legal obligations to prepare and present annual report to financial authorities and shareholders. This means annual report is an important component of legal compliance. It must be prepared according to applicable rules and regulations.

3. Build Trust

This document helps build trust between the company and shareholders. In today’s highly competitive business environment, trust is a valuable asset. By providing accurate and detailed information in the annual report, the company can strengthen relationships with shareholders and other stakeholders.

4. Communication Tool

Annual report is an important communication tool used by companies to talk to the outside world about achievements and plans. It is a way to share the company’s vision, core values, and long-term goals. Through the annual report, the company can explain its business strategy to shareholders and stakeholders.

5. Decision-Making

Shareholders and company management use the annual report as a basis for smart business decisions. The information presented in this report can help evaluate company performance, identify potential risks, and plan necessary actions for long-term growth and success.
